The Department of Energy Office of Fossil Energy and Carbon Management published a Notice of Availability on December 20, 2024 for the 2024 LNG Export Study, a multi-volume analysis updating DOE's understanding of U.S. LNG export effects on the domestic economy, household energy costs, energy security, and global greenhouse gas emissions. The Study comprises a summary report and four appendices using multiple modeling frameworks including GCAM, NEMS, and NETL consequential lifecycle analysis. DOE will use the Study to inform public interest determinations in 14 pending non-FTA LNG export application proceedings. Comments are due by February 18, 2025. DOE will not revise the Study based on comments received.12
